It's official: Drake and Future are back with new music and there's a new video to go with it. The two rappers have just shared visuals for their new single "Life Is Good." Unsurprisingly, fans are now going nuts on social media.

In the video, Drake and Future are working random jobs, from waste collectors to fast-food workers, and chefs cooking up a storm in the kitchen. Helmed by Director X, the clip also features cameos from 21 Savage, Lil Yatchy, and Mike WiLL Made-It.

Though there is still no word on when their rumored sequel to What a Time to Be Alive will drop, it's safe to assume that "Life Is Good" will be included in the project. Following the video release, Drake and Future fans took to Twitter to voice their excitement, as well as create hilarious memes.
